Design Notes for Optimal Results

Here are some practical tips based on my testing:

  1. Test on scrap fabric: Before finalizing any project, embroider the design onto a sample of your target fabric to assess how it looks and holds up.
  2. Review stitch density: Especially in the text areas, too much stitch density can lead to puckering or distortion. Adjust accordingly for your fabric type.
  3. Check thread color contrast: Use a light-colored thread (like white or cream) for maximum visibility on darker or medium-toned fabrics.
  4. Confirm hoop size: Larger formats work better here, so don’t try to force it into a smaller hoop unless you're willing to scale down carefully.
  5. Use proper stabilizer: A tear-away or cut-away stabilizer is recommended depending on the fabric thickness and stretchiness.
  6. Inspect small details: Look closely at the corners and edges of letters to ensure they won’t fray or misalign during stitching.
  7. Consider black and white mockups: Sometimes seeing the design in grayscale helps determine whether it will still look good without color variation.
  8. Compare light and dark backgrounds: Try the design on both types of fabric to see which offers the best contrast and aesthetic appeal.
